Cosmic Endeavour Rounds Out Stellar Group 1 Season

Cosmic Endeavour today claimed the final Group 1 race of the 2013/14 Australian racing season, which has been another stellar 12 months for graduates of Inglis sales.

The Gai Waterhouse trained Cosmic Endeavour (Northern Meteor x Crevette) was sent out favourite for today’s Tatteralls Tiara at Eagle Farm and after a textbook ride by Tommy Berry the filly proved too good for her opposition.

Inglis graduates have starred at the highest level during the current season with wins in Group 1 races from 1000m to 2500m, such as the Lightning Stakes, Golden Slipper, Australian Guineas, WS Cox Plate, Caulfield Cup and three Derbies (Victoria, South Australia and Queensland).

Bred by Mrs CB Remond, Cosmic Endeavour was a $230,000 purchase for owners Don & Judy Kelly from Willow Park Stud’s draft at the 2012 Inglis Australian Easter Yearling Sale.

Willow Park offered six fillies at the 2012 Easter Sale – five are winners, including Group 1 victors Cosmic Endeavour and Bounding, plus Group 3 winner Jazz Song.

Cosmic Endeavour has really come into her own this year winning the Gr.2 ATC Sapphire Stakes, RL Inglis Guineas and Gr.2 BRC Dane Ripper Stakes in the lead up to Saturday’s triumph. The three-year-old filly has netted over $1 million for her connections during her racing career to date.

“She’s a very tough filly who has had a long campaign but has kept improving every start. It’s great for Don and Judy, who have been great supporters of the stable,” said Adrian Bott, racing manager for Gai Waterhouse.

The daughter of Northern Meteor is the second Inglis Guineas winner to venture straight to the Brisbane winter carnival and to Group 1 success. The other was Sincero, which won the Stradbroke Handicap in 2011 four weeks after his Inglis Guineas win.
